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Heathrow Terminals 2 & 3 (Rail Station Only) to Birkenhead Central start from £104.20 one way, or £153.40 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Heathrow Terminals 2 & 3 (Rail Station Only) to Birkenhead Central are available for £201.90 one way, or £392.30 return

Facilities and Amenities at Your Service

With an eye to comfort and convenience, the station offers a robust array of facilities. The ticket office is open daily from 5:00 AM to just before midnight, ensuring no traveler is left without assistance. Accessibility is a primary focus here, with step-free access available throughout the station, including to the platforms and the ticket office. While ticket machines are accessible to everyone, at this time the station does not offer smartcards, though you can conveniently collect tickets purchased online at the machine.

While you won't find a dedicated waiting room, there's ample seating, and assistance is available throughout the week to provide support when needed. If you're in need of some last-minute shopping or currency exchange, the station hosts a variety of shops, including ATMs and currency exchange services. However, bear in mind that refreshment facilities are not available within the station itself.

Facilities and Amenities at Birkenhead Central Station

The station is equipped with several essential facilities, ensuring that all passengers have a comfortable experience while waiting for their train. Although the station does not have ticket machines, it boasts a ticket office where tickets can be purchased or collected. This office is accessible seven days a week, from early in the morning until late at night. For those who prefer smart travel, smartcard issuance and validation are available, making ticket management easy and efficient.

Travelers with accessibility needs will be pleased to know that Birkenhead Central offers step-free access throughout the station, including lifts to all platforms. However, there are no ticket barriers, which is something to keep in mind for ease of movement. Unfortunately, there are no accessible ticket machines, but assistance is readily available from station staff during operational hours. The station is committed to providing support for all travelers, with induction loops available for those with hearing impairments.

Convenient Transport Links

Birkenhead Central is not just a gateway to the rail network; it's also perfectly positioned for further exploration by other modes of transport. While there is no direct taxi rank or car hire facilities at the station, buses serve the local area with ease, and detailed onward travel information is readily accessible here.

Should you need to fly, the nearest airport, Liverpool John Lennon Airport, is conveniently accessible with combined rail/bus tickets available from any Merseyrail station. Strategic bus connections from Liverpool South Parkway station make reaching your flight a breeze.
